Halfshafts break for a couple of reasons. Impact and over-extension.

Over extension can happen during both up travel and down travel. The more speed involved increases the chances of over-extension. This probably the reason more folks break front end stuff in mud/dirt/wet situations vs rock/moab situations.

The reason the half shafts were changed was because they added a bit of length to them. IIRC the engineers told me 3/8", this helped reduce the issues with over-extension pulling the shafts out of position.

There is a certain amount of plunge type movement in the CV Joints, both inner and outer. You can google 'rezeppa style cv' to get an idea what is under the boots. H1's and H2's have rezeppas on one end (outer) and tripots (tripods) on the inner. H3's have rezeppa's on both inner and outer. This is why the H3 has more travel than the H2 and H1, but with the choice of GM to use such a small ,weak, aluminum center section, it made the front diff of the H3 a major failure point.

The "C" clip does not have to fail for the shaft to be pulled out of the differential. An over extension can possibly pull the shaft out with a new snap ring. If the snap ring does fail, there would be nothing retaining the shaft in the axle tube mount bracket and eventually suspension movement will result in the half-shaft compressing beyond the point where the splines are meshed and ..... very interesting when the spline try to meet again.

When you replace a half-shaft, in the tear down, all you have to do is make a quick firm pull straight out and the shaft will pull out of the diff axle tube (passenger side). When install the replacement you push the inner end into the diff axle tube with the splines lined up until you hear the C clip "click" indicating it is in position at the proper depth, give it a little wiggle to make sure it is gripped by the snap ring, and good to go.

The 08 Alpha (09+) half-shafts are definitely longer that the early versions and beefier as well.

"PN 10374204 was changed due to an insertion issue that would sometimes arise into the differential. It was supposed to break point sometime around January 2006 to PN 15905106

The PN 15905106 was changed to PN 15886012 with an implementation of November 2006. This change was to increase the shaft bar length to 341mm and increase the shaft diameter between the boots to 28.6mm. The inboard joint also changed (was increased) due to off-road warranty issues."

Yes Sir, pushed together as far as it will go (its shortest possible length).

For those inquiring minds: The inner joint (tri-pod assembly/joint) is completely flexible AND moves with an in and out motion. The outer joint (CV joint) is also flexible, but cannot move in and out. What I am looking for is the total axle shaft length with the tri-pod inner end fully compressed in.
